Individuals entering a 60 day Rehab Program at facilities in Gordon can expect a structured and comprehensive approach to recovery. The program typically begins with a thorough assessment where treatment teams evaluate the patient's medical history, addiction severity, and specific needs. Following this assessment, patients typically undergo detoxification, where they will receive medical support to manage withdrawal symptoms safely. Once detox is complete, residents transition into intensive therapies, which may include cognitive-behavioral therapy, group counseling, and skill-building sessions aimed at addressing the triggers and psychological facets of their addiction. Patients are encouraged to participate actively in all aspects of treatment, including individual therapy sessions and group workshops focusing on life skills, stress management, and relapse prevention. Throughout the duration of the stay, a wide array of holistic therapies such as art therapy, yoga, and mindfulness may be integrated into the treatment plan, aiming to promote overall well-being. As individuals progress, they may move towards outpatient care while continuing their therapy sessions. Additionally, aftercare planning is generally a significant component, aiming for seamless integration back into their lives with support via follow-up appointments and group therapy sessions. The overall experience is designed to foster healing, skills development, and ongoing support necessary for successful recovery.
